To add a new grid to your report:
Point to where you want to place the upper left corner of the grid, and then drag to the desired size.
In Select a Database Connection, select a database connection, and then click OK.
In the Dimension Layout window, drag the dimension icons from the Attribute Dimensions frames, if they exist, and from Point of View frames into the Pages, Rows, or Columns frames, and then click OK.
When you add a new grid, the system assigns a default name to the grid. You can rename the grid in the Dimension Layout dialog box or when you save it. The default name assigned is Gridn, where n is a system-assigned identification number. For example, if you save a grid that is the sixth system-named grid saved in the report, the default name is Grid6.
The system uses the grid name when a function or chart references the grid. For example, if you design a chart to graphically display the data from a grid, the chart properties must reference the grid by its name.
